Vernon Gordon Petherick (20 April 1876 – 14 August 1945) was an Australian politician who represented the South Australian House of Assembly seat of Victoria from 1918 to 1924, 1932 to 1938 and 1941 to 1945 for the Liberal Union, Liberal Federation and Liberal and Country League.[1]
